At the mid-1840s height of the industrial revolution, there were clay pits and brickyards all over the area. The most extensive brick plant was in North Cambridge.

Cambridge will be on the hook for between $257 million and $2.4 billion in costs to fix sewer overflows. Residential water bills will rise significantly.
